Associated Short article No, asphalt roof shingles ought to not be power washed. A power washing machine or pressure washing machine is as well strong to use on asphalt tiles and will certainly loosen the adhesive holding them to your roof, causing them to diminish. It's finest to hire a local roof covering cleaner to clean up those shingles securely and without harming them.




Soft cleaning includes a naturally degradable cleansing service being sprayed on the roof covering and delicately rinsed away after it liquifies built-up deposit on your shingles. The most effective time of year to cleanse your roofing system is late springtime into very early summertime. You wish to have the ability to count on completely dry weather and clear skies to be able to do the job appropriately, which these seasons often tend to have most generously.

You have a handful of choices for cleaning your level roof covering, each of which has advantages and disadvantages. The initial choice is utilizing a pressure washer, which can conveniently get rid of algae and moss and efficiently tidy your level roof covering. Among the advantages of this technique is that it does not make use of any kind of chemicals, meaning that you don't need to bother with the soil and plants around your building being polluted or harmed.

The dimension of your roof covering and the sort of roofing are mosting likely to impact for how long the procedure takes.


Typically, it costs in between $0.20 and $0.70 to cleanse a roofing system per square foot. This indicates that a 2,000-square-foot roof covering will cost in between $400 and $1,400 to tidy. As an example, if your roofing system is covered in dark algae, this can imply that your roofing system absorbs more heat and, in turn, raises the temperature level in your attic room. The result is that your A/C needs to run more frequently and endure more damage.
